“I attended a wedding feast for the Prophet in which there was no meat and no bread.” Ibn Majah said: It was not narrated except by Ibn `Uyainah.
that the Prophet said: “When anyone of you gets a new wife, a servant, or an animal, let him take hold of the forelock and say: Allahumma inni as`aluka min khayriha wa khayri ma jubilat 'alaihi, wa 'audhu bika min sharriha wa sharri ma jubilat `alaih (O Allah, I ask You for the goodness within her and the goodness that she is inclined towards, and I seek refuge with you from the evil to which she is inclined).' ”
that the Messenger of Allah married her when he was Halal (not in Ihram). (Sahih).He (one of the narrators-Yazid) said: "And she was my maternal aunt and the maternal aunt of Idn 'Abbas also."
the Prophet cursed the woman who does hair extensions and the one who has that done, and the woman who does tattoos and the one who has that done.
the Messenger of Allah returned his daughter to Abul-'As bin Rabi' after two years, on the basis of the first marriage contract.
the Messenger of Allah, returned his daughter Zainab to Abul-As bin Rabi', with a new marriage contract.
